Strategic Partnerships Enhance Regional Health Tourism Value Chains

Effective regional partnerships in health tourism are built upon shared vision, clear communication, and proactive leadership, often facilitated by state and regional management initiatives.

Journal of Management · 2023

01

Key Findings

  • 01Power relations between stakeholders significantly impact partnership effectiveness.
  • 02A lack of common vision and competing interests are major barriers to collaboration.
  • 03Effective dialogue, leadership, and compatible communication styles are essential.
  • 04State and regional management play a vital role in initiating and organizing cooperation.

Method & Evidence

AimWhat are the key factors influencing the effectiveness of regional organizational partnerships in the health tourism industry?
MethodExpert Evaluation
ProcedureThe research involved experts evaluating opportunities for improving regional partnerships in health tourism, focusing on factors influencing collaboration and the role of management in initiating and sustaining these partnerships.
ContextHealth Tourism Industry

Limitations

This study relies on expert opinions, which may not fully represent the practical challenges faced by all participants in regional partnerships. The focus is specifically on health tourism.

Reliability & validity

The reliability and validity of the expert evaluation method would depend on the selection criteria for experts and the structured nature of the evaluation process. Triangulation with other data sources could enhance validity.
